Young Ones celebrate
Date published: 14 December 2009

Elsie Bell, Liz Garlick (young parent support worker), Amy Livsley, Councillor Dale Mulgrew, Ruth Mallory, Katie Burke and Nikki Barker.
The Sandbrook Children’s centre in Rochdale has held a party to celebrate the achievements of a group of young parents.
‘The Young Ones’ is ran by a group of young parents for others like themselves. During their weekly meetings they have attended sessions on crafts, home safety, cooking and careers and future planning.
The party was attended by many of their young parents and the staff who support the group as well as Councillor Dale Mulgrew and Ben Collier of Link 4 Life who provided a dance mat session.
Councillor Mulgrew presented the parents with certificates of achievement acknowledging the tremendous work they have done.
The Young Ones plan on bringing 2010 in with a bang when they will start a decorating and home improvement course being organised and provided by Kirkholt Drop In Centre.
Speaking at the event Councillor Dale Mulgrew said: “The Young Ones provide a shining example to young parents across Rochdale and across the country. Too often young single parents must face personal barriers which leave them struggling to cope and to improve their lives and their children’s lives themselves. The Young Ones have demonstrated how with hard work, dedication and sheer willpower these barriers can be overcome.
“By holding weekly meetings at a set time and location the single mothers involved are showing their commitment to the program and their desire to improve their lives. Moreover with the help and support of the staff members these women are making little steps to improve their lives and the lives of their children. It is absolutely vital that these sorts of schemes continue to flourish.”
